
The World Cup play-offs conclude on Tuesday night, with the final six remaining nations to be decided for the revamped 48-team tournament.
Four nations will qualify through the UEFA play-offs, with a further two sides progressing as winners of the two intercontinental playoff finals and booking their place at the showpiece in the United Sates, Canada and Mexico.
It all kicks off with the opener between Mexico and South Africa on 11 June at Estadio Azteca, beginning the 23rd edition of the World Cup.
